## Green Initiatives on BBAU Campus
* **Solar Energy:** Rooftop solar panel installation.
* **Waste Management:** Composting units and waste segregation.
* **Water Conservation:** Rainwater harvesting and recycling plants.

## The Shift to Renewables (SDG 7)
* Global energy investment trends for 2023: Renewables (**$1,700 Billion**) vs. Fossil Fuels (**$1,100 Billion**).
